1. Tegallalang Rice Terraces:
One of the most iconic sights in Ubud, the Tegallalang Rice Terraces are a must-visit for anyone looking to capture the beauty of Bali’s landscape. The cascading green terraces create a stunning backdrop for your photos, especially during sunrise or sunset when the light is just right. Be sure to explore the terraces and find the perfect spot to capture the beauty of this UNESCO World Heritage site.
2. Campuhan Ridge Walk:
For a more serene and peaceful setting, head to the Campuhan Ridge Walk in Ubud. This scenic walking trail offers breathtaking views of lush greenery and rolling hills, making it a perfect spot for capturing some nature-inspired shots. The best time to visit is early morning or late afternoon when the light is soft and golden, creating a magical atmosphere for your photos.
3. Ayung River:
The Ayung River is a popular spot for white-water rafting, but it also offers great photo opportunities. The lush jungle surroundings and crystal-clear waters make for stunning backdrops for your Instagram photos. Consider taking a river rafting tour or simply explore the riverbanks to find the perfect spot for your shot.

7. Tirta Empul Temple:
Located near Ubud, Tirta Empul Temple is a sacred water temple known for its holy spring water that is believed to have healing properties. The temple’s intricate Balinese architecture and serene atmosphere make it a great spot for capturing some cultural shots for your Instagram feed. Be sure to respect the temple’s customs and dress modestly when visiting.
